Douglas X-3 Stiletto
The Douglas X-3 Stiletto was a 1950s United States experimental jet aircraft with a slender fuselage and a long tapered nose, manufactured by the Douglas Aircraft Company. Its primary mission was to investigate the design features of an aircraft suitable for sustained supersonic speeds, which included the first use of titanium in major airframe components. Douglas designed the X-3 with the goal of a maximum speed of approximately 2,000 m.p.h,but it was, however, seriously underpowered for this purpose and could not even exceed Mach 1 in level flight.
Role | Experimental |
---|---|
Manufacturer | Douglas |
Designer | Schuyler Kleinhans, Baily Oswald and Francis Clauser |
First flight | 15 October 1952 |
Retired | 23 May 1956 |
Status | Preserved at National Museum of the United States Air Force |
Primary users | United States Air Force NACA |
Number built | 1 |
General characteristics
- Crew: 1
- Length: 66 ft 9 in (20.35 m)
- Wingspan: 22 ft 8 in (6.91 m)
- Height: 12 ft 6 in (3.82 m)
- Wing area: 166.5 sq ft (15.47 m2)
- Aspect ratio: 3
- Empty weight: 14,345 lb (6,507 kg)
- Gross weight: 20,800 lb (9,435 kg)
- Max takeoff weight: 22,400 lb (10,160 kg)
- Powerplant: 2 × Westinghouse XJ34-WE-17 afterburning turbojets, 3,370 lbf (15.0 kN) thrust each dry, 4,900 lbf (22 kN) with afterburner
Performance
- Maximum speed: 613.5 kn (706 mph; 1,136 km/h) at 20,000 ft (6,100 m)
- Maximum speed: Mach 0.987
- Range: 432 nmi (497 mi; 800 km)
- Endurance: 1 hour at 512.7 kn (590.0 mph; 949.5 km/h)at 30,000 ft (9,100 m)
- Service ceiling: 38,000 ft (12,000 m) absolute
- Rate of climb: 19,000 ft/min (97 m/s)
- Wing loading: 124.9 lb/sq ft (610 kg/m2)
- Thrust/weight: 0.4762 lbf/lb (0.004670 kN/kg)
